Synopsis

Mention of the 1960s often arouses strong emotions even in those who were already old when they began and those who were not even born when they ended. For some, it is a golden age of liberation and political progressiveness; others see it as a time when the secure framework of morality, authority and discipline disintegrated. Arthur Marwick's book is a study of social and cultural change in Europe and the United States in a period of outstanding historical significance, analyzing phenomena as diverse as the rise of youth culture, the impact of the civil rights movement, feminism, sexual permissiveness, the rise of rock music and the reassessment of traditional attitudes to class, race and the family.

Review

These days it seems obligatory to either be for or against the 1960s. Arthur Marwick, Professor of history at The Open University, is definitely for them. He likes them so much that this massive--900 close typed pages--account of the decade starts in 1958 and doesn't finish until 1974, but this unorthodox time frame, from the end of post- war austerity to the crunch of the mid-seventies oil crisis, is well chosen. It allows Marwick to place all the famous sixties incidents--the Paris riots, the Vietnam war and protest against the war, Mick Jagger being arrested, the fight for the right to abortion etc.--not only in an historical context, but also to then follow them through to their various conclusions. Marwick focuses on Britain, France, Italy and the United States and while the cultural developments remain in the memory, it was the economic progress, allied to a baby boom, that really invigorated this decade. In America the percentage of the population below the poverty line halved in the years between 1965 and 1975 while in Italy the number of families with television sets and fridges doubled over the same period. "There has been nothing quite like it", Marwick persuasively argues; "nothing would ever be the same again". --Nick Wroe

Review

"Marwick has made genuine contribution, first in affirming the reality of the cultural revolution as it manifested itself in so many spheres of life; then in showing how that revolution permeated and transformed mainstream society; and finally in putting it all in an international perspective,
exposing the differences and yet basic similarities provided by the perspective."--The Washington Post Book World
"An ambitious synthesis.... Mr. Marwick's prodigious research and encyclopedic scope will make this book a helpful and entertaining reference work for a time to come."--Washington Times
